What is an SIP Calculator?
An SIP calculator is an online tool that helps investors estimate the potential returns on their SIP investments based on key inputs such as:
✔ Monthly Investment Amount (SIP amount) 💰
✔ Expected Annual Return Rate 📈
✔ Investment Duration ⏳
✔ Total Corpus at Maturity 🏦
It works on the compound interest formula, making it easier for investors to plan their investments efficiently.
How to Use an SIP Calculator Effectively
Using an SIP calculator is simple, but to get the most out of it, you need to understand its components and how to tweak them for better results. Here’s a step-by-step guide:
1. Choose the Right SIP Calculator
Not all SIP calculators are built the same. Some offer additional features like step-up SIP calculations, inflation adjustment, and goal-based planning. Choose a trusted SIP calculator, such as those available on mutual fund websites, financial blogs, or mobile apps.
2. Input the Correct Data
To get accurate results, ensure you enter realistic values for:
- SIP Amount: The fixed monthly amount you wish to invest
- Investment Duration: The time period (in years) for which you plan to invest
- Expected Return Rate: Use historical return rates or realistic market estimates (typically 10-15% for equity mutual funds)
3. Understand the Results
Once you enter the inputs, the calculator will generate:
✔ Total Invested Amount 🏦
✔ Estimated Returns 📊
✔ Maturity Value 🎯
✔ Wealth Gain 💹
Use these values to compare different investment scenarios.
4. Experiment with Different Scenarios
To make the most of an SIP calculator, try changing variables:
- Increase your SIP amount by 10-15% yearly to see compounding benefits
- Adjust the investment tenure to compare short-term vs. long-term growth
- Modify the expected return rate to factor in market fluctuations
5. Plan for Inflation
Inflation erodes purchasing power, so your investment returns should outpace inflation. For example, if inflation is 6% and your SIP return is 12%, your actual growth is only 6%.
💡 Pro Tip: Use an SIP calculator with an inflation-adjustment feature to get a realistic future value.
6. Avoid Common Mistakes
❌ Overestimating Returns: Markets are volatile; do not assume unrealistic high returns.
❌ Ignoring Step-up SIP: Increasing SIP contributions annually boosts final corpus significantly.
❌ Not Factoring in Market Risks: Diversify across funds for better risk management.
Example of SIP Calculation
Let’s take an example of Amit, who wants to invest ₹10,000 per month in an SIP for 15 years with an expected return of 12% per annum.
SIP Amount | Investment Duration | Expected Returns | Total Investment | Estimated Maturity Amount |
---|---|---|---|---|
₹10,000 | 15 years | 12% p.a. | ₹18,00,000 | ₹50,45,760 |
So, Amit’s wealth gain over 15 years will be approximately ₹32,45,760.
